ABOUT KEON COLEMAN
American football player who rose to fame as a wide receiver for the Michigan State University Spartans. He also played six games for Michigan State's basketball team. In the year 2023, he joined the Florida State University Seminoles.
He played high school football and basketball for Opelousas Catholic School.
He led the Spartans in receiving yards during the year 2022. He has shared moments from his college football career on his keoncoleman3 Instagram account. He stands 6'4" and weighs 215 pounds. He was drafted by the Buffalo Bills in 2024.
He is originally from Opelousas, Louisiana. He has 2 brothers and 2 sisters and was raised by a single mom.
He and Amari Cooper both play as wide receivers for the Bills.
